Life in a 55+ Community

One of the key differences between independent living and a 55+ community is how the community is structured. Individuals who move into a 55+ community can expect to find a dedicated neighborhood designed specifically for older adults. Although there may be other entry requirements, the first and most obvious is age.

Another difference is that many 55+ communities require homeownership. While residences are within a gated-style community, individuals have to buy their property and either handle the maintenance themselves or pay additional fees for lawn mowing, power washing, etc. In addition, unlike independent living, a 55+ community rarely offers additional services such as housekeeping, on-site dining, and life enrichment programs.

Some 55+ communities will feature shared spaces such as a community pool or clubhouse, but that is not always the case. However, these communities are good options for active retirees who want to maintain their independence in their homes while living in a secure neighborhood surrounded by peers.
